    Re: Laws & Gravity

    JB pretty much hit the nail so hard it left a big, deep, circle in the frame from the hammer. You cannot say, "Hey! Admins! We are losing, so kick these guys so we can win!"

    TTP has been around BF2 for awhile, and they have found that this is an effective way to win for a team.

    RHYS, its part of the game. No one likes to be on the recieving end of base raping; it leaves a bad taste in your mouth for a while. What you got to do in these situations is rally together and find a way to either repel the threat, or find a way to out flank the hostiles and get on their rear.

    If its a tank, jump in some armor or grab a HAT/LAT. If its CAS, grab a AA kit (many people forget about this kit), or jump on the AA around the base. Then, when the opprutunity is right, you can do your team a favor by destroying their assets before they pose a threat to your troops.

    Had the developers not wanted to allow base raping, they'd of put a bubble of death around it, jsut like the LZ's on Zatar or Hills of Hymong.

    Its part of the game, and the reason a lot of servers make it a rule is because they get droves of people bitching and whining about how they are losing. Its a temporary problem that will go away with a little strategy on your part, or just give it time and someone else will step up to the plate and take care of the problem.
